为什么区块链不能与甲骨文分开?这是怎么一回事?

区块链技术中常提到预言机(Oracle),听起来好像能预测未来一样,让人产生歧义。Oracle 这个单词的直译是“预言、神谕”,也有权威的意思。

Oracle在区块链技术中经常被提及。听起来好像可以预测未来,这让人很困惑。甲骨文的直译是“预言,甲骨文”,也有权威意义。

甲骨文所提到的区块链行业并不意味着“预言”,而是数据的真实性和权威性。把甲骨文翻译成“可信的数据提供者”可能更合适。因此,甲骨文是提供链上可靠数据的工具,文献点是连接区块链与现实世界的桥梁。

甲骨文的工作原理:当区块链上的智能合约有数据交互需求时,甲骨文会在收到需求后,帮助智能合约收集链外的外部数据,经验证后将获取的数据反馈给链上的智能合约。

你为什么需要一台预测机?

因为区块链上的智能合约和分散应用(DAPP)对外部数据有交互需求。

区块链是一个封闭的环境,链外的真实世界数据无法在链上获得。主要原因是区块链不能主动发起网络呼叫,而链上的智能合约被动接收数据。其次,智能合约不是“智能”的,只有在满足相应条件的情况下,智能合约才会达到触发状态。同时,智能合约的最终执行需要合约参与者的私钥签署,智能合约本身无法自动执行。

当智能合约的触发条件依赖于区块链外的信息时,需要先将信息写入区块链的记录中。此时,需要甲骨文提供区块链之外的信息。

让我们举一个容易理解的例子。假设我被关在一间小而黑的房间里。我不知道外面发生了什么。我不知道外面有没有人。即使有电话,也不会有人回应。只有外面有人在门口告诉我,我才能知道外面发生了什么事。

智能合约与本例中的“I”类似。它不能主动向外界寻求信息,只能向外界发送信息或数据。先知是在门口收到我的请求后从外面传递信息和数据的人。

也许你会问为什么不能直接在链上导入和接收数据?这主要是因为区块链的共识机制。区块链是一个基于共识的网络。它运行的智能合约也需要一个确定性程序。在每个事务和块处理之后,每个节点必须达到相同的状态。然而,数据本身是复杂多样的,这就是为什么甲骨文为了适应区块链的共识机制,除了收集数据,将最终的“确定性”信息反馈给智能合约之外,还有一个数据验证步骤。

哪些团队正在开发甲骨文?

1、 口语化:

Oracle是一个为以太坊提供集中式数据传输Oracle服务的项目。它依靠Amazon AWS服务和tlsnotary认证技术来提供Oracle服务。

在区块链环境中,Oracle将获取的信息返回给链,并确保数据与数据源相同,用户可以自己获取数据。Oracle不干涉信息源的选择和信息源本身的准确性。

2、占卜:

与甲骨文的集中化不同,八月是一个分散的预测市场平台。Augu的核心是对市场进行预测,市场预测主要通过利益驱动的投票机制来决定结果。

用户可以用数字货币进行预测和下注,依靠群体智慧预测事件的发展结果。用户可以选择围绕任何未来事件创建预测市场,参与者可以对该事件的结果下注。参与者的输赢取决于未来活动的实际结果。该平台本身无法验证事件的真实结果,因此八月依靠用户和复杂的结果报告系统来鼓励诚实的结果报告。

3、链接:

Chainlink是第一个去中心化的甲骨文。与Oracle的集中化相比,chainlink更符合去中心化区块链的原则。Chainlink主要为智能合约提供Oracle服务,访问链外密钥资源、网站API和传统银行账户支付。

链下的节点提供数据,链链的上部收集数据请求需求,然后收集相应节点的答案,经过加权后反馈给信息请求者。Chainlink还有一个节点信誉评估系统。信息需求方可以选择具有特定信誉等级的节点,每次信息反馈后更新每个节点的信誉得分。

甲骨文项目能否投产?

毫无疑问,Oracle是构建BLASH链世界的工具之一,但目前Oracle项目还不成熟,实用性差。在这种情况下,这些项目值得参与吗?

区块链项目没有公认的估值模式,我们投资的大部分是未来价值。像一些互联网公司一样,即使年复一年亏损,其股价仍在攀升。而目前我们的利率可能处于牛市,市场人气相对较高,更容易出现非理性飙升。

但话说回来,因为大部分投资都是未来的价值。当然,面临的风险非常大。回首17年的牛市,回笼资金大多回落。最近,甲骨文董事会刚刚经历了一次大幅度的上涨,因此我们应该注意风险,谨慎参与。

发布者:6116,转请注明出处:https://www.btchangqing.cn/92603.html

发表评论

登录后才能评论
商务微信
商务微信
客服QQ
分享本页
返回顶部